To most tourists and conventioneers, New Orleans is simply a place sensuality, a town where they may indulge in things they would never allow themselves at home. One thing they do not expect is Charlie Boy --- a killer who sleeops during the day and moves out into the stream of hookers and hucksters that flows through the gaudy attractions of Bourbon Street. Among this year's tourists is a Boston doctor, in town for a medical convention. Josiah Moment has never been away from home. He has lived the life most of us live. He has never been unfaithful to his wife or to his practice -- until now -- when the things that happoen to him combine with his instinctive hatred for injustice and threaten to alter the course of his existence. The author has captured the pace and picdture of a city where tradition reigns, wheere vilence lurks always just beheanth the surface of a casual sexuality. A fascinating cast of characteers --- both high born and low, eccentric and conventional. feibleman grew up in New Orleans, which formed the background of his first novel, A Place Without Twilight.
